hero


152
companies
1,610
Jobs

Senior Engineering Manager - Web Platform

Rippling

Rippling

Software Engineering, Other Engineering
Bengaluru, Karnataka, India
Posted on Thursday, November 2, 2023
About Rippling
Rippling is the first way for businesses to manage all of their HR & IT—payroll, benefits, computers, apps, and more—in one unified workforce platform.
By connecting every business system to one source of truth for employee data, businesses can automate all of the manual work they normally need to do to make employee changes. Take onboarding, for example. With Rippling, you can just click a button and set up a new employees’ payroll, health insurance, work computer, and third-party apps—like Slack, Zoom, and Office 365—all within 90 seconds.
Based in San Francisco, CA, Rippling has raised $1.2B from the world's top investors-including Kleiner Perkins, Founders Fund, Sequoia, Bedrock, and Greenoaks - and was named one of America's best startup employers by Forbes (#12 out of 500)
About the role
At Rippling, Engineering is at the heart of our business and culture. We’re looking for an Engineering Manager to lead the design system team which is responsible for building core elements for a seamless user experience and consistent look and feel. We follow a well-defined process for designing, building, and documenting components which are accessible and i18n compatible. You will be primarily responsible for building and scaling multiple areas of design system’s. This is a high ownership, impact, and visibility role that will create a step change in Rippling’s growth and technological evolution.
What you will do
  • Lead the design systems team based on priority business needs and evolving customer use cases

  • Attracting, recruiting, hiring, developing and retaining your amazing team which Craft and build internal frontend tooling and libraries to optimize developer efficiency and increase code reliability and performance.

  • Engage with latest technology and industry UI trends to continually evolve and improve the application experience.

  • Grow your team's abilities through coaching, mentoring and consistent one-on-one conversations.

  • Drive technical excellence, operational maturity, innovation and quality processes within your team.

What you will need
  • At least 8 years of experience in software development and delivery, with in-depth knowledge of software architectures; must have at least 2 years of experience as an Engineering Managers in leading small and mid-sized development teams

  • A Bachelor’s or Master's degree in computer science, information technology, or experience in a relevant field

  • Solid programming skills, a track record, and passion for improving the code structure and architecture to enhance testability and maintainability

  • Team development skills: ability to set a roadmap and goals for a team and every one of its members, delegate intelligently, offer engineering advice, deliver frequent and transparent feedback, work with team members to grow in their careers, and ensure everyone delivers quality results

  • Great project management skills to lead, care about product ownership, an outstanding customer-centric mindset, and solving problems for our customers.

Additional Information